Creating new approaches to develop Personalized Analgesics®

  • The clinical success rate for developing an analgesic is 2% - five times lower than other therapeutic areas.

 

  • Current treatment options are limited with only 1 in 8 people receiving satisfactory pain relief with standard of care. 

 

  • We have to change how we conduct R&D and link research to specific pain conditions to create Personalized Analgesics®.

Keys to Analgesic Innovation

01

understand the patient

Listen and learn from patients to create patient inspired R&D

02

Disease understanding

Increase knowledge of the 100+ conditions associated with chronic pain

03

link target to disease

Move away from relying on 'preclinical' data to define clinical development

04

Develop in the right patients

Break away from only developing in the  ~10 regulatory approved conditions

05

create the right patient outcomes

Develop patient outcome measures based on patients needs for each condition

06

increase female focused research

Take into account inherent gender bias and explore female pain conditions
